How to Melt Milk Chocolate?

There are two ways to melt milk chocolate: the microwave method and the double boiler method.

For the microwave method, chop the chocolate into small pieces and place them in a microwave-safe bowl. Microwave the chocolate in 15-second intervals, stirring after each interval until the chocolate is melted and smooth.

For the double boiler method, place a heatproof bowl over a pot of simmering water. Make sure the bowl doesn't touch the water. Add the chocolate to the bowl and stir until melted and smooth.

Be careful not to overheat the chocolate, as this can cause it to seize up and become grainy. If the chocolate does seize up, add a tablespoon of vegetable oil or shortening and stir until the chocolate becomes smooth again.
